Bodum Bistro Flatbread Toaster Stylishly practical, the colorful array of Bodum Bistro Flatbread toasters brings some delicious decor into your kitchen. Forgoing the usual slot design, the flat-bread toaster accommodates baguettes, croissants and hot pocket paninis on a stainless steel flatbed. Catering to the ongoing need of apartment dwellers for precious counter-space the flat-bread toaster can be stored on its side.

Dramatic growth has seen the number of supermarkets in Scotland double in the past decade to more than 400, with a further 30 stores currently in the pipeline.
Analysis carried out by The Herald has found that the number of superstores owned by the eight major supermarket chains surged from 206 to 408 between 2000 and 2009.
The driving force behind the remarkable expansion has been Tesco, which has more than doubled its Scottish presence since 2000 by building 44 new stores.
Its branches now cover the furthest reaches of Scotland, from the Western Isles and Shetland to Castle Douglas and Dumfries.
Discounter Lidl has also enjoyed a phenomenal rise. It owns 89 stores, three times the number it had in 2000, while Morrisons, Asda and Somerfield all have at least 60% more supermarkets than a decade ago.
Sainsbury’s has the lowest market share of the recognised major players with 28 branches, but with 14 planning applications on the go it has the most aggressive expansion strategy.
